Pasenusios „Linux“ tinklo komandos ir jų keitimai


Ankstesniame straipsnyje apžvelgėme keletą naudingų „Sysadmin“ komandų eilutės tinklo paslaugų, skirtų tinklo valdymui, trikčių šalinimui ir derinimui „Linux“. Minėjome kai kurias tinklo komandas, kurios vis dar įtrauktos ir palaikomos daugelyje „Linux“ paskirstymų, tačiau dabar iš tikrųjų yra pasenusios arba pasenusios, todėl turėtų būti vykdomos norint pakeisti dabartinius.

Nors šiuos tinklo įrankius/paslaugas vis dar galima rasti oficialiose pagrindinių Linux platinimų saugyklose, tačiau iš tikrųjų pagal numatytuosius nustatymus jie nėra iš anksto įdiegti.

Tai akivaizdu naudojant Enterprise Linux platinimus, kai kurios populiarios tinklo komandos nebeveikia RHEL/CentOS 7, o iš tikrųjų veikia RHEL/CentOS 6<.. Naujausiuose Debian ir Ubuntu leidimuose jų taip pat nėra.

Šiame straipsnyje pasidalinsime pasenusiomis „Linux“ tinklo komandomis ir jų pakaitalais. Šios komandos apima ifconfig, netstat, arp, iwconfig, iptunnel, nameif, taip pat route .

Visos išvardytos programos, išskyrus iwconfig, yra net-tools pakete, kuris tiek metų nebuvo aktyviai prižiūrimas.

Svarbu nepamiršti, kad „neprižiūrima programinė įranga yra pavojinga“, ji kelia didelį pavojų jūsų „Linux“ sistemos saugumui. Šiuolaikinis net-tools pakaitalas yra iproute2 – paslaugų, skirtų valdyti TCP/IP tinklą Linux sistemoje, asortimentas.

Šioje lentelėje pateikiama tikslių pasenusių komandų ir jų pakeitimų, į kuriuos turėtumėte atkreipti dėmesį, suvestinė.

arp

ip n (ip kaimynas)

ifconfig

ip a (ip addr), ip nuoroda, ip -s (ip -stats)

iptunnel

ip tunelis

iwconfig

oi

nameif

ip nuoroda, ifrename

netstat

ss, ip maršrutas (skirtas netstat -r), ip -s nuoroda (skirtas netstat -i), ip maddr (skirtas netstat -g)

route

ip r (ip maršrutas)

Daugiau informacijos apie kai kuriuos pakeitimus rasite šiuose vadovuose.

  1. ifconfig vs ip: koks skirtumas ir tinklo konfigūracijos palyginimas
  2. 10 naudingų „IP“ komandų tinklo sąsajoms konfigūruoti

Apskritai, verta nepamiršti šių pakeitimų, nes dauguma šių pasenusių įrankių kada nors bus visiškai pakeisti. Seni įpročiai miršta sunkiai, bet jūs turite judėti toliau. Be to, neprižiūrimų paketų diegimas ir naudojimas jūsų Linux sistemoje yra nesaugi ir pavojinga praktika.

Ar vis dar naudojate šias senas/nebenaudojamas komandas? Kaip susitvarkote su pakaitalais? Pasidalykite savo mintimis su mumis naudodami toliau pateiktą atsiliepimų formą.